Transaction 075f695da8cd0109657d2d2bbcaa32cea73376aa48a36e4fb7e34aa0e4046119

3 Input
2 Outputs
  • 075f695da8cd0109657d2d2bbcaa32cea73376aa48a36e4fb7e34aa0e4046119:0
  • value  1486
    address  15Ryf5zDMggmg1GUAK9T3iyNAGJpkNAKbX
  • 075f695da8cd0109657d2d2bbcaa32cea73376aa48a36e4fb7e34aa0e4046119:1
  • value  19790000
    address  3M5bQx9K4Em9KEig21Y2F6ESrLLUTvE2xy